About Salaiya Village

Salaiya is a small village in Saraiyahat tehsil, in the district of Dumka, Jharkhand.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 358, made up of 178 males and 180 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,011 females per 1000 males. The village covers 92.43 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 814151,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Salaiya

The census records public bus service for Salaiya as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 10+ km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
